BS6 Bajaj Pulsar NS160 Price Hiked By Rs 1500

  • Published On: 17 July 2020
  • 100 Views

BS6 Bajaj Pulsar NS 160 gets a price increase of Rs 1500.

Bajaj Auto has announced a price hike on selected BS6 models in the Indian markets. Bajaj Pulsar Series is one of the popular motorcycles from the Indian two-wheeler giant. Recently, Bajaj Pulsar NS 160 got a second price hike of Rs 1500. Bajaj Pulsar NS 160 was launched in India in April 2020. The less powerful sibling of NS 200, Pulsar NS 160 was earlier priced at Rs 1.04 lakh (ex-showroom), Delhi at the time of its launch. With the new round of hike, Bajaj Pulsar NS 160 price now is Rs 1.07 lakh (ex-showroom), Delhi. The bike is sold in three colours namely Fossil Grey, Wild Red and Saffire Blue. 

The 160cc motorcycle does not come with any design updates, it is identical to the outgoing BS4 model. BS6 Pulsar NS 160 key highlights include a semi-digital instrument cluster, split seats, engine cowl, aggressive halogen headlight and alloy wheels. The two-wheeler comes with aggressive and muscular styling. Thus what you see is a muscular fuel tank, clip-on handlebars, backlit switchgear are some other defining features of this bike.  

BS6 Bajaj Pulsar NS160 Price Hiked

The Bajaj Pulsar NS160 is powered by a BS6 4 Stroke, SOHC 4 Valve, Oil Cooled, Twin Spark BSVI DTS-i FI engine. The engine churns out 17.2 bhp of maximum power @ 9,000 RPM and 14.6 Nm of peak torque @ 7,250 rpm. The powertrain comes mated to a 6-speed gearbox. Fuel-injection system is added to the BS6 engine, it improves the bike’s performance as well as fuel economy. 

BS6 Bajaj Pulsar NS 160

Bajaj Auto retains the mechanical components of the BS4 model. The Bajaj Pulsar NS 160 is equipped with a 260 mm front disc and 230 mm rear disc along with a single-channel ABS. Telescopic with Anti-friction Bush at the front and Nitrox mono shock absorber with Canister towards the rear takes care of suspension duties. Total fuel capacity of the naked street racer is 12-litres. The ground clearance of the bike stands at 177 (mm) while the bike weighs 151 kgs.
